Hello to the group.

I'm probably going to be acquiring a '46 Champ project in the near future
and I've never done a recover before. I've been reading a little about
Ceconite and Poly Fiber - For you old heads at this - Is one better than
another? Are there plusses & minuses that I should know about before

picking
one over the other?


Get the manuals and study both processes. I learned on Stits, which is now
Polyfiber. Maybe you should check out Airtech too. I don't think you
could go wrong with Polyfiber.
